Hackers Poison Adform Script to Swap Crypto Wallet Addresses Across Customer Sites

The Hacker News Cybersecurity Score 6/10

Summary

Attackers modified a JavaScript file served by advertising technology company Adform, turning it into a browser-side tool that rewrites cryptocurrency wallet addresses. Adform detected the incident on July 27, 2026, removed the malicious code, notified affected clients, and reported it to authorities.
